THE ROLE OF PSYCHOLOGICAL AND PEDAGOGICAL KNOWLEDGE IN FORMING THE NEED FOR SELF-EXPRESSION STUDENTS IN THE FUTURE PROFESSIONAL ACTIVITY
The aim o f the article is to determine the importance in terms of psychological and pedagogical knowledge about social selfidentification of personality in the process of forming students' needs of self expression in their future professional activity.
